Transaction 709973c4766cda5955ef18fa298a89a9559b1a96565be78e15de141d828583d9
1 Input
1 Output
-
709973c4766cda5955ef18fa298a89a9559b1a96565be78e15de141d828583d9:0
- value
- 210830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6eb995ab2414c7c9237776521148f586bf558b9b OP_EQUAL
- address
- 3BnUaHtyhmHRDpK3845cw2W1Rexq9f5ZQn